Transaction 62689927bc67103f670423d6c10191d1887386f6ef308ef64f31cd18dff02d74
1 Input
1 Output
-
62689927bc67103f670423d6c10191d1887386f6ef308ef64f31cd18dff02d74:0
- value
- 2498668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ead39d8c64d2dfdb253522b039e1103308c62782 OP_EQUAL
- address
- 3P6fYjGAVGshNDvtPcGpFy7wuneGZ5VVit